John Thomas Davies VCTrying to trace relatives or friends

John Davies has the unusual distinction of being possibly the only man to be awarded a posthumous Victoria Cross (for his gallantry in France in March 1918) who survived and was decorated with the VC by the King. He was presumed killed in the VC action but had actually been taken prisoner and survived the war in a PoW camp in Silesia. He spent most of his working life employed at the Ravenhead Brick & Tile Works.
